150. MOCK GOLD
Fuse together 16 parts of copper, 7 of platinum, and 1 of zinc. When steel is alloyed with 1/500 part of platinum, or with 1/500 part of silver, it is rendered much harder, more malleable, and better adapted for all kinds of cutting instruments. Note.—In making alloys, care must be taken to have the more infusible metals melted first, and afterwards add the others.
